Hey Marta,

Quick handover before I'm off: the turnstile upgrade on the Fenwick Building ground floor finishes Thursday. Contractors from Ashgrove Systems will need escorting in and out, so keep the visitor log handy. The old readers are dead already — everyone goes through the side gate for now. The temporary gate code is just below.

door code, fawip-yagef: bdg-NPIWQ-43434

## 7.0.0 — Changed defaults

Legacy Quillbase ORM layer refactored into the new mapper. Lazy loading now off by default; explicit fetch plans required. Connection pool shrunk to sane sizes. Old annotations still parse but log deprecation warnings. Migration script handles schema drift automatically. After the refactor, the service starts with the following configuration values.

service settings:
[casax]
port = 6379
team = rusir
host = casax.zemvarhq.corp
region = outer-4
access_code = ac_9808ce
timeout_ms = 1500

### Step 6: Deploy the bloom filter layer

Deploy Siftgate, the bloom filter fronting the Pebblestore key-value cluster, only after the store reports healthy. Verify the false-positive rate config matches production (0.1%) before promoting; a mismatch silently wastes backend lookups. The deploy must be signed, or the orchestrator rejects it. Sign using the deploy key below:

release key, fajef-kajeg: bky19_LdLu6Ne6FLi8he2c24d

Renamed setting: SNAPCHECK_AUTH has been renamed to SNAPCHECK_UPLOAD_TOKEN in Brimstead's UI snapshot pipeline, to clarify that it authorizes baseline image uploads only. The old name is no longer read as of v3.2, and fallback logic was removed to reduce audit surface. Update each runner's .env to include the line:

secret setting of hawep-yahig: LEDGER_TOKEN29=41b5d6315371c92885eaeb077fb63

Tenants on the Brinemarsh cluster are exceeding their per-tenant rate quotas without throttling. The quota ledger in Meterline resets on node restart, so limits silently vanish mid-window. New folks: quotas live in the ledger service, not the gateway config. Reproduce by restarting any ledger pod during an active window. The failing deploy is identified by the token below.

build token for kagaf-hahof: htk14_9d3d4d26d7d8de